Abstract
A disk drive has on-board soft error recovery procedures for recovering data following a soft error, and the capability to selectively disable or limit this feature. Preferably, a set of data storage devices are used to store heterogeneous data, i.e., to store some alphanumeric data, and some multimedia data. If a disk drive is selected for storage of multimedia data, the soft error recovery is disabled, and soft errors are simply transmitted to the host system as data. If each disk surface may be independently allocated to data of different types, soft error recovery may be independently disabled for each disk surface.

10. A rotating disk drive data storage device, comprising:
-
a disk drive base;
at least one rotatably mounted disk for recording data on at least one surface of said at least one rotatably mounted disk;
a movable actuator supporting at least one transducer head, said actuator positioning said at least one transducer head to access data on said at least one surface of said at least one rotatably mounted disk; and
a controller for controlling the operation of said disk drive data storage device, said controller including a soft error recovery function for recovering from soft errors detected during data access, said controller further including a disabling function which disables said soft error recovery function responsive to an external command from a host system;
wherein said disabling function includes the capability to disable said soft error recovery function with respect to data stored in selective individual portions of the data storage area of said disk drive, said individual portions being less than the entire data storage area of said disk drive. - View Dependent Claims (11, 12, 13, 14)

15. A control program for a rotating disk drive data storage device, comprising:
-
a plurality of processor-executable instructions recorded on signal-bearing media, wherein said instructions, when executed by at least one processor control apparatus of a rotating disk drive data storage device, cause the device to perform the steps of;
(a) performing a sequence of soft error recovery steps responsive to the detection of a soft error from performing of a data access operation during operation of said rotating disk drive data storage device, at least some of said soft error recovery steps involving re-performing said data access operation;
(b) receiving a soft error recovery function disable command from an external device; and
(c) disabling at least one soft error recovery step of said sequence of soft error recovery steps for at least a portion of said rotating disk drive storage device responsive to receiving said soft error recovery disable command, wherein at least one of the disabled soft error recovery steps involves re-performing said data access operation. - View Dependent Claims (16, 17, 18, 19)
